Transaction 79edaa91eb70c3068583490a76bcc1b103ff2d4c8aeb4f01525f18ed2fee6784

5 Input
2 Outputs
  • 79edaa91eb70c3068583490a76bcc1b103ff2d4c8aeb4f01525f18ed2fee6784:0
  • value  902673
    address  1MUh9rscfhpUBDQRCHGrzedPxVjTSDtDNp
  • 79edaa91eb70c3068583490a76bcc1b103ff2d4c8aeb4f01525f18ed2fee6784:1
  • value  3980000
    address  18PVntQCmbSydAdu99F1nPLBfkQmtMErF9